PJ Morton is coming to a city near you! The singer/musician has announced his summer 2016 tour with The PJ Morton Trio.
The 19-city tour — which features Morton, drummer Ed Clark and bassist Brian Cockerham — will kick off on June 23 in Chicago.
The trio will serve as a supporting act for singer-songwriter Emily King at select shows, while also headlining many venues, tapping into local music scenes for opening acts.
Last month, Morton released his video for “I Need Your Love” from his mixtape Bounce & Soul: Vol. 1.
